More than 200 people turned out to show their support for a new skate park in Halstead.

An awareness day was organised by Halstead Youth Council and took place on Saturday.

The youth council has been campaigning for a new skate park for the last four years, but are hampered by funding issues.

There was the chance to have a go at graffiti art with Scott Irving, from Brave Arts, enjoy bouncy play equipment and other games, as well as refreshments being available.

The fun day was paid for by a grant from Halstead Town Council and a grant from Active Essex, Essex County Council’s community fund.

Linda Hilton, of Halstead Residents Association, said: β€œIt was a very hot day and everyone enjoyed themselves and the community of Ramsey Road Park came together to support our camping for a new skate park for Halstead.”
